python多文件打包_python打包多类型文件的操作方法

环境win10, python3.7,pyinstaller3.6

一 下载pyinstaller

(1)cmd中pip install pyinstaller

(2)pycharm中file—settings—project Interpreter----右上角‘+'----搜索puinstaller----install package

成功即可!

二 主程序打包

打开cmd,cd到程序文件夹位置

2020092111044435.png

由于文件夹中有多个子文件夹,包含多个程序,找到主程序的位置,

使用命令行:pyinstaller -F D:\db\监控系统(2020.9.15)\systemcode\maincode.py

注意:一定使用绝对路径!!

2020092111044436.png

successfully之后文件夹中会增加几个子文件,如下图红框所示;

2020092111044437.png

三 打包所有文件

要打包的文件中除了.py文件之外,还有其他诸如txt,ttf,pth等文件,如果将其与py文件放在一块,打包时会出现错误,先将py之外的文件放在一边。

1.打开上图中的maincode.spec文件(我用的是notepad++),

2020092111044438.png

上图‘1'中放的是除了主程序maincode.py之外的其他py文件,记得用‘\\',用逗号隔开;

‘2'中增加的是exe中使用的图标地址,用绝对路径。

2.cmd中写命令行:

pyinstaller -F -w -i D:\db\监控系统(2020.9.15)\systemcode\logo.ico maincode.spec

2020092111044539.png

成功之后,打开文件夹中的dist文件,这里是存放exe程序的位置。

2020092111044540.png

上边步骤忽略的其他文件(txt等)放在与exe文件同级的文件夹中。双击exe即可!

如上!!

到此这篇关于python打包多类型文件的操作方法的文章就介绍到这了,更多相关python打包多类型文件内容请搜索脚本之家以前的文章或继续浏览下面的相关文章希望大家以后多多支持脚本之家!

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值